Model Analytics & Market Report
We've analyzed more than 125,600 sales records of this model and here are some numbers.
The average price for new (MSRP) 2018 GMC TERRAIN in 2018 was $34,095.
The average price for used 2018 GMC TERRAIN nowadays in 2024 is $18,823 which is 55% from the original price.
Estimated mileage driven per year is 12,091 miles.

Depreciation
The graph below is a depreciation curve for 2018 GMC TERRAIN. It shows how much this model looses per year in price. This analytics is calculated using sales records from BADVIN database.
The table below shows average price for used 2018 GMC TERRAIN in each year since the year of manufacturing, current year price and projected price in the future years.
You can scroll the table horizontally to see all columns.
Year | Average Mileage | Average Price | % Left | % Lost | ||
---|---|---|---|---|---|---|
2018 MSRP | 0 mi | $34,095 | — | — | 100% | 0% |
2018 | 12,091 mi | $30,000 | +$4,095 | +12.01% | 87.99% | 12.01% |
2019 | 24,182 mi | $27,599 | +$2,401 | +8% | 80.95% | 19.05% |
2020 | 36,273 mi | $24,998 | +$2,601 | +9.42% | 73.32% | 26.68% |
2021 | 48,364 mi | $23,500 | +$1,498 | +5.99% | 68.93% | 31.07% |
2022 | 60,455 mi | $22,582 | +$918 | +3.91% | 66.23% | 33.77% |
